DevOps Engineer

LendingTreeCharlotte, NC
11dHybrid

About The Position

The DevOps Engineer supports reliable software delivery by helping maintain and improve CI/CD workflows, automation, and operational practices. This is an entry-level position: success is measured by learning quickly, executing well-defined tasks, improving documentation, and contributing to team reliability with guidance from senior engineers.

Requirements

  • 0-2 years of relevant experience (internships, co-ops, academic projects, or equivalent hands-on work are acceptable).
  • Working knowledge of Git and a basic understanding of modern SDLC practices.
  • Comfort operating in Linux environments and using the command line for routine tasks.
  • Basic scripting ability (Bash) and the ability to read and modify scripts with guidance.
  • Clear written communication skills and attention to detail, especially for creating and maintaining documentation.

Nice To Haves

  • Exposure to AWS fundamentals (compute, networking, IAM concepts, and managed services).
  • Familiarity with GitLab (repositories, merge requests, and CI/CD pipelines).
  • Introductory programming experience in Python and/or C#.
  • Basic familiarity with containerization (Docker concepts such as images, containers, and registries).
  • Experience writing or maintaining technical documentation (wikis, runbooks, tutorials, or internal guides).

Responsibilities

  • Support build, deployment, and configuration management activities for applications and services.
  • Assist with CI/CD pipeline upkeep (e.g., troubleshooting pipeline failures, improving pipeline reliability, and documenting pipeline usage).
  • Help implement and maintain automation for routine operational tasks (e.g., environment setup, deploy steps, basic health checks).
  • Participate in incident response as appropriate for level, following runbooks and escalating when needed; contribute to post-incident follow-ups by updating documentation.
  • Support monitoring and alerting hygiene (e.g., alert tuning suggestions, dashboard updates, basic log/metric validation) under direction.
  • Maintain internal documentation as a standard part of day-to-day work (runbooks, SOPs, troubleshooting guides, and deployment documentation).
  • Collaborate with software engineers, security, and platform teams to understand workflows and document repeatable procedures.

Stand Out From the Crowd

Upload your resume and get instant feedback on how well it matches this job.

Upload and Match Resume

What This Job Offers

Job Type

Full-time

Career Level

Entry Level

Education Level

No Education Listed

Number of Employees

501-1,000 employees

©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service